<p>Preregistration includes specific details about how our analyses were planned and initially executed. (Preregistration can be found here: https://osf.io/xj9vk/ )</p> <p>Two new covariates (not included in preregistered analyses) were added to our regression analyses after collection of data and after we ran our preregistered analyses. Addition of these covariates did not meaningfully change our results or the interpretation of our results. They did, however, provide some explanation for additional variance in our dependent variables. </p> <p>The new covariates (assigned sex at birth and gender identity) were added after data showed that they were not collinear. Both of these variables were included because neither was a more theoretically sound variable to include than the other. </p> <p>Final results include assigned sex at birth and gender identity as covariates in addition to age, religiosity, and acculturation. </p>
